Design and build quality
The X4 embodies Sebo's reputation for robust construction. The chassis feels solid, with a smooth, purposeful action when you push it across a room. The hose and wand connectors lock securely, reducing wobble during edge-cleaning and upholstery work. The power switch and height adjuster are positioned for instinctive reach, which reduces interruptions mid-clean. The dusting brush and upholstery nozzle click on with confidence, and the bag system is designed for straightforward removal and replacement. A key consideration for homeowners is storage: the X4's relatively compact profile helps it tuck into closets or utility rooms without dominating space.
Performance on carpets and hard floors
On low-pile carpets, the Automatic height adjustment engages promptly, lifting suction slightly to maximize agitation without sacrificing pile health. On hardwood and tile, suction remains strong while avoiding surface scuffing, thanks to well-tuned air paths and a helpful glide. In practical terms, this translates to fewer passes to achieve visible cleanliness and better edge-to-edge coverage. We tested both dense area rugs and large living-room carpets to gauge consistency. The X4 performed well in both environments, with only minor differences in edge cleaning efficiency on very shaggy textures. For households with mixed surfaces, this model provides a predictable cleaning rhythm that reduces the need to swap tools constantly.
Pet hair handling and filtration
Pet owners require a vacuum that can lift fur without clogging or losing suction quickly. The X4 uses Sebo's filtration approach and a relatively airtight canister to minimize exhaust back into the room. In our trials with multi-pet households, the X4 captured most hair from upholstery, stairs, and furniture with minimal need for repeated passes. The sealed system supports better allergen containment, which is a meaningful benefit for allergy-conscious homes. Regular maintenance—like emptying the bag and checking the filter—helps sustain peak performance over time.

Troubleshooting and common issues
Some users may encounter occasional clogging if the bag becomes overfilled or hair accumulates in the hose. Regularly checking the hose and nozzle for obstructions can help maintain airflow. If you notice decreased suction or unusual noises, start with a filter and bag inspection, then verify that the height adjustment is functioning correctly. For persistent issues, consult the warranty terms or contact an authorized service center to avoid voiding coverage.
Practical care routines to maximize lifespan
Establish a simple weekly routine that includes emptying the bag when it reaches about half-full, inspecting and cleaning the brush roll, and checking air paths for blockages. Schedule a more thorough cleaning every few months: replace filters, vacuum the motor compartment for debris, and inspect the wand and hose connections for wear. Keeping the exterior clean and lubricating moving parts, where applicable, can help extend the X4's service life. A light maintenance habit yields longer sustainment of performance.
